The Tab Is Sky High, Too :: Dinner In The Sky, Belgium

But for a really sky high dining experience, you can try Dinner in thy Sky. It’s the brainchild of Quentin Jadoul, a chef from Belgium, and it’s basically a long table that seats 20, serves gourmet meals, and is held 50 meters into the sky by a crane. Waiters included.
Better yet, it’s got wheels, meaning you can order it to come to any city on the European continent. So if you’ve got an extra $20,000 to enjoy great views, great service, and equally great food with wine, enjoy a dinner where the sky’s the limit.
